Articles of asp.net mvc

OwinStartup non si triggers

Ho avuto il codice di configurazione OwinStartup perfettamente funzionante e poi ha smesso di funzionare. Sfortunatamente non sono sicuro di quello che ho fatto per farla smettere di funzionare e sto facendo davvero fatica a capirlo. Per assicurarmi di avere le nozioni di base, ho controllato per accertarmi che abbia il [assembly:OwinStartup(typeof(WebApplication.Startup))] attributo assegnato correttamente […]

Memorizza / assegna ruoli di utenti autenticati

Sto aggiornando un sito per utilizzare MVC e sto cercando il modo migliore per configurare l’autenticazione. A questo punto, ho il log-in fuori da Active Directory: convalidare un nome utente e una password, e quindi impostare il cookie Auth. Come posso archiviare le informazioni sul ruolo dell’utente al momento del log-in, in modo che i […]

Pagine SSL in ASP.NET MVC

Come faccio a utilizzare HTTPS per alcune delle pagine nel mio sito basato su ASP.NET MVC? Steve Sanderson ha un buon tutorial su come farlo in modo DRY su Anteprima 4 in: http://blog.codeville.net/2008/08/05/adding-httpsssl-support-to-aspnet-mvc-routing/ C’è un modo migliore / aggiornato con Anteprima 5 ?,

MVC 5 Accesso reclami Id quadro Dati utente

Sto sviluppando un’applicazione web MVC 5 utilizzando l’approccio Database First di Entity Framework 5 . Sto usando OWIN per l’autenticazione degli utenti. Qui sotto mostra il mio metodo di Login all’interno del mio Account Controller. public ActionResult Login(LoginViewModel model, string returnUrl) { if (ModelState.IsValid) { var user = _AccountService.VerifyPassword(model.UserName, model.Password, false); if (user != null) […]

Visual Studio 2015 Broken Razor Intellisense

Dopo aver installato e poi riparato l’istanza VS2015, non riesco ancora a far funzionare intellisense (lato server) nelle mie visualizzazioni MVC. Vengo avvisato tramite messaggio di richiesta non appena apro per la prima volta in una sessione un file .cshtml e viene indirizzato al file Activitylog. Messaggio di errore recuperato in ActivityLog.xml (versione breve): System.ArgumentException: […]

asp.net MVC azione di controllo della vista parziale

Sono molto nuovo allo sviluppo di app Web e ho pensato che avrei iniziato con la tecnologia recente e quindi sto cercando di imparare asp.net insieme al framework MVC in una volta. Questa è probabilmente una domanda molto semplice per voi, professionisti MVC. La mia domanda è se una vista parziale dovesse avere un’azione associata […]

Limita l’accesso a un controller specifico tramite l’indirizzo IP in ASP.NET MVC Beta

Ho un progetto MVC ASP.NET che contiene una class AdminController e mi dà URL come questi: http://example.com/admin/AddCustomer http://examle.com/Admin/ListCustomers Voglio configurare il server / app in modo che gli URI contenenti / Admin siano accessibili solo dalla rete 192.168.0.0/24 (cioè la nostra LAN) Mi piacerebbe limitare questo controller per essere accessibile solo da determinati indirizzi IP. […]

Conversione della funzione ASP.NET MVC Razor @helper in un metodo di una class helper

Si consideri il seguente snippet di visualizzazione del razor ASP.NET MVC che definisce un helper @helper FieldFor(Expression<Func> expression) { @Html.LabelFor(expression, htmlAttributes: new {@class = “control-label col-md-2”}) @Html.EditorFor(expression, new { htmlAttributes = new {@class = “form-control”} }) @Html.ValidationMessageFor(expression, “”, new {@class = “text-danger”}) } Qual è il modello per convertirlo in un metodo di una class […]

Come raggruppare su 2 quadro figlio e ottenere il totale di entrambe queste entity framework figlio?

Voglio ottenere le varianti totali eseguire per la mia Test Version 0 vale Test Id=100 Questa è la mia tabella e i miei record: Test: Id Version 100 0 varianti: Id Name Type CategoryId 11 Variant1 Diff 2 12 Variant1 Add 2 13 Variant2 Add 3 14 Variant2 Diff 2 15 Variant3 Add 6 SubVariants […]

Come utilizzare knockout.js con ASP.NET MVC ViewModels?

generosità È passato un po ‘di tempo e ho ancora un paio di domande in sospeso. Spero che aggiungendo una taglia, queste domande avranno una risposta. Come si usano helper HTML con knockout.js Perché il documento era pronto per farlo funzionare (vedi prima modifica per maggiori informazioni) Come faccio a fare qualcosa di simile se […]